Ben Briney
Camp Director, Head Volleyball Coach
Ben Briney will begin his 5th season as head coach. He has lead the team to a 96-42 record. The team has been nationally ranked for 36 weeks, including two weeks in the Top Ten, and three trips to the NCAA tournament during his tenure. Briney also coached the school’s second AVCA National Freshman of the Year and only 4x All American., Megan Sharpe.
As head coach Briney has coach 22 All-MIAA award winners, two MIAA Freshman of the Year, and has had a player earn All-American every year. During his time as an assistant the Bulldogs went 137-22, twice made the National Quarterfinals, and a trip to the National Semi-finals in 2008. Overall Briney has coached eight different players to 16 All-America Awards.
Megan Wargo-Kearney
Assistant Camp Director, Truman Assistant Coach
Megan Wargo-Kearney begins her fifth season as the assistant coach at Truman. Wargo assisted head coach Ben Briney in leading the Bulldogs to a 96-42 overall record and three NCAA tournament appearances.
Prior to her joining the Bulldog coaching staff in the fall of 2009, Wargo spent four seasons as the
assistant coach for both the women’s and men’s volleyball at Lees-McRae College, a Div. II institution located in Banner Elk, N.C. LMC reached the NCAA women’s tournament three times with Wargo serving as the program’s assistant and won three straight Conference Carolinas tournament championships. The Bobcat women’s program compiled a 101-46 record during her four-year tenure.
